Hi Tammy, And as Mango Trees are sun emergent forest dwellers (like avocados), they are basically evolutionarily designed to germinate in the shade of larger trees, and shoot up through the layers of forest around them in the competition for light and to find a hole up in the canopy and reach for it and then and only then push its head out into the bright sunlight it so craves. In our neck of the woods, the absolute lowest temperatures occur in December or January near to the shortest days of the year when the jet stream decides to alter it's normal direction of flow from west to east normally blowing relatively warm air off the Pacific onto California and instead runs up to the Arctic, grabs a bunch of super chilled air, then heads down over Western Canada, heads across the border over Montana, Idaho, and Washington State, runs across Oregon and Nevada and then ultimately enters California over the already frigid Cascades and Sierra Nevada and into our backyards. Bay Area microclimates that would be ideal for mangoes would be mostly frost free slopes of the Southern Bay Area such as Hayward, Fremont, San Jose etc where the temps are warmer because of the distance from the cold fog door of the Golden Gate opening, or open ocean exposure, or deep inland like places like Pittsburg, Antioch or Oakley where it also gets hot but where you are close to the delta waters which also moderate winter time lows.
